Empowering Families with Support in Jerusalem

Empowering Families with Support in Jerusalem

Sam is almost two now, and he almost never stops smiling. His story started at birth, when he suffered from a lack of oxygen. His mother says, “before he was nine months old, I recognized that he wasn’t able to sit properly, crawl or make any movement.” Yet she hesitated to seek treatment, as many in Jerusalem try to hide children with special needs.

When Sam’s development wasn’t improving, his mother took him to a pediatrician, and then a neurologist. Then came the final MRI result that determined Sam had cerebral palsy.

On admission to Jerusalem Princess Basma Centre, an institution of our partner, the Diocese of Jerusalem, Sam was able to receive the comprehensive therapy he needed — and his mother benefited from the Mother and Family Empowerment Program. She now proudly tells her son’s story to encourage other children and families in similar situations.
